A Graduate Certificate in Loose Parts Play is increasingly significant for developing leadership skills in today’s market, particularly in the UK. With 72% of employers prioritizing leadership and problem-solving skills, according to a 2023 report by the Confederation of British Industry (CBI), this certification equips professionals with innovative approaches to foster creativity, collaboration, and adaptability in teams. Loose Parts Play, a concept rooted in open-ended, unstructured play, encourages critical thinking and decision-making—key traits for effective leadership. The UK’s education and childcare sectors are witnessing a surge in demand for leaders who can integrate play-based learning into organizational strategies. A 2022 survey by the National Day Nurseries Association (NDNA) revealed that 65% of nurseries are investing in leadership training to enhance staff capabilities. This trend underscores the relevance of a Graduate Certificate in Loose Parts Play, which bridges the gap between theoretical knowledge and practical application, preparing leaders to navigate complex, dynamic environments.
